AMBER ALERT has been deactivated after 13-year-old Pueblo girl was found safe

UPDATE: The CBI has deactivated the Amber Alert after Sanda Mendoza was found safe.

PUEBLO, Colo. (KRDO) — The Pueblo Police Department (PPD) is asking for the community's help in locating a teenage girl who was in a truck when it was stolen in Pueblo on Wednesday.

PPD first reported the incident just before 7 p.m

Shortly before 9 p.m., the Colorado Bureau of Investigation (CBI) issued an Amber Alert for 13-year-old Sandra Mendoza. The CBI said the stolen vehicle was recovered by law enforcement agencies but Sandra was still missing.

Photos of the vehicle, teen and suspect can be seen above. The vehicle's registration number is BLB-C78. It was stolen from the 1200 block of S. Prairie Avenue. It was recovered in the 1100 block of Cypress Street.

The suspect was described as a Hispanic male. Sandara, 13, is described as a Hispanic female with hazel eyes and black hair. She was last seen wearing a black shirt and blue jeans.
